Date: | Thursday 30 October 1952 |
Time: | |
Type: | Stinson 108-3 Voyager |
Owner/operator: | |
Registration: | F-BECL |
MSN: | 4207 |
Fatalities: | Fatalities: 1 / Occupants: |
Aircraft damage: | Destroyed |
Location: | Chup, 50 mi E of Phnom Penh -
Cambodia
|
Phase: | Landing |
Nature: | Unknown |
Departure airport: | |
Destination airport: | |
Confidence Rating: | Information is only available from news, social media or unofficial sources |
Narrative:Single-engines plane belonging to a rubber plantation crashed on landing on a roadway. Pilot Jean Girard killed and his passengers were injured.
